ROAD TEST (A140E)
NOTICE: Perform the test at normal operating fluid
temperature (122 ± 176°F or 50 ± 84°C). .
1. D RANGE TEST IN NORM AND PWR PATTERN
RANGES
Shift into the D range and hold the accelerator pedal
constant at the full throttle valve opening position.
Check the following:
(a) 1±2, 2±3 and 3±O/D up±shifts should take place, and
shift points should conform to those shown in the au-
tomatic shift schedule. (See page AT±49)
Conduct a test under both Normal and Power patterns.
HINT:
There is no O/D up±shift when coolant temperature is
below 122
°F (50°C).
There is no lock±up when the vehicle speed is 10 km/h (6
mph) less than the set cruise control speed.
EVALUATION
(1) If there is no 1 ± 2 up±shift:
wNo. 2 solenoid is stuck
w1±2 shift valve is stuck
(2) If there is no 2 ± 3 up±shift:
w No. 1 solenoid is stuck
w2±3 shift valve is stuck
(3) If there is no 3 ± O/D up±shift:
w3±O/D shift valve is stuck
(4) If the shift point is defective:
wThrottle valve, 1±2 shift valve, 2±3 .shift valve, 3±
wO/D shift valve etc., are defective
(5) If the lock±up is defective:
wLock±up solenoid is stuck
wLock±up relay valve is stuck
(b) In the same manner, check the shock and slip at the 1
±2, 2 ± 3 and 3 ± O/D up±shifts.
EVALUATION
If the shock is excessive:
wLine pressure is too high
wAccumulator is defective
wCheck ball is defective
(c) Run at the D range lock±up or O/D gear and check for
abnormal noise and vibration.
HINT: The check for the cause of abnormal noise and
vibration must be make with extreme care as it could
also be due to loss of balance in the drive shaft, tire,
torque converter, etc.

ROAD TEST (A140L)
NOTICE: Perform the test at norrnal operating fluid tem-
perature (122 ± 176°F or 50 ± 80°C).
1. D RANGE TEST
Shift into the D range and hold the accelerator pedal
constant at the full throttle valve opening position.
Check the following:
(a) 1±2, 2±3 and 3±0ID up±shifts should take place, and
shift points should conform to those shown in the au-
tomatic shift schedule. (See page AT±49)
EVALUATION
(1) If there is no 1 ±2 up±shift:
wGovernor valve is defective
w 1±2 shift valve is stuck
(2) if there is no 2 ±3 up±shift:
w 2±3 shift valve is stuck .
(3) If there is no 3 ± O/D up±shift:
w3±O/D shift valve is stuck
wO/D solenoid is defective
(4) If the shift point is defective:
wThrottle cable is out±of±adjustment
wThrottle valve, 1±2 shift valve, 2±3 shift valve, 3±
O/D shift valve etc., are defective
(b) In the same manner, check the shock and slip at the
1± 2, 2 ± 3 and 3 ± O/D up±shifts.
EVALUATION
If the shock is excessive:
wLine pressure is too high
Accumulator is defective
wCheck ball is defective
(c) Run at the D range lock±up or O/D gear and check for
abnormal noise and vibration.
HINT: The check for the cause of abnormal noise and
vibration must be make with extreme care as it could
also be due to loss of balance in the drive shaft, tire,
torque converter, etc.
